Medicare Beneficiary Identifiers (MBIs)

The Center for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) is sending new Medicare cards to beneficiaries as part of an effort to comply with a law that requires them to remove Social Security numbers (SSNs) from all Medicare cards.

 

The new cards are for original Medicare and do not apply to Medicare Advantage plans, such as the ones EmblemHealth/ConnectiCare offer. EmblemHealth/ConnectiCare Medicare Advantage ID cards do not use or include SSNs and are not impacted by this change. Please continue to use our identification numbers located on the applicable member ID card for claims and other transactions.

CMS encourages providers to use these new Medicare Beneficiary Identifiers (MBIs). MBIs should be treated like personal health information. To find out what the new cards mean for providers, check out this resource from CMS.

Remind your patients to get their flu vaccine

Remind your patients that although they received a flu vaccine last year, the flu virus changes each year and a new vaccine is needed. Speak with your patients about the vaccine’s safety and minor effects that may occur, such as injection site tenderness. Please remember that if the vaccine is the only reason for the office visit, then no copayment is collected. If your office does not carry the vaccine, direct your patients to their local pharmacy.

Accredo’s Convenient Care Program

EmblemHealth is partnering with Accredo Specialty Pharmacy to provide members with home infusion treatments through Accredo’s Convenient Care Program. Effective March 1, 2020, the specialty drugs on the list here will no longer be covered in an outpatient setting. Members using an outpatient setting for their treatments will be responsible for the full cost of their drugs and treatment.

To facilitate the transition to this new program, an Accredo pharmacist will reach out to prescribers for new prescription(s). Once the prescription is in place, an Accredo representative will call the member to schedule the delivery of the medicine(s) and/or treatment(s). Members may request a one-time-only refill of their specialty medicine(s) at their current provider after March 1, 2020, if needed.

Use network labs – Quest Diagnostics and AmeriPath

Quest Diagnostics and its affiliate, AmeriPath, are our preferred lab s. When an out-of-network lab is used, the data is not available to EmblemHealth for our disease management programs. This may result in inaccurate reporting and the possibility of practitioners and/or members being told a test is needed when it may have already been done.
